In-Depth Itinerary Breakdown
.jpg)
Pickup and Cycling to the Village
Your day begins with a pick-up at your hotel in Hoi An, followed by a bike ride into the countryside. The relaxed pace makes it easy to soak in the scenery — the vibrant rice paddies, the sound of water buffalo grazing, and the peaceful atmosphere that defines rural Vietnam.
Visiting a Fishing Village
Next, you arrive at a local fishing village where guides share stories about the community’s livelihood and history. We appreciated the opportunity to relax over local tea and observe daily life unfold — fishing nets, boat repairs, and villagers going about their routines. This authenticity is what makes the experience memorable.
Basket Boat Experience & Traditional Fishing
The real fun begins with learning how to navigate a basket boat. These colorful, circular boats are a staple for local fishermen, and you’ll get a chance to try your hand at various fishing techniques. As one reviewer put it, “I loved trying a bunch of different fishing methods,” highlighting how interactive and engaging this part of the tour is.

Riding Water Buffalo & Exploring Rice Fields
Following the fishing, you’ll ride a water buffalo, which is surprisingly gentle and slow-paced — perfect for photo ops and feeling connected to the land. You’ll also explore nearby paddy fields, learning about rice cultivation, an essential part of Vietnam’s economy and daily life.
Relaxing in a Fishing Village & Cooking with Locals
After working up an appetite, you’ll relax over tea before heading to a local family’s home. Here, the highlight is cooking your own lunch — a genuine opportunity to learn about Vietnamese cuisine. The hosts are friendly, and the meal, typically included in the tour price, provides a delicious reward for your efforts.
Return to Your Hotel
The day wraps up with a bicycle ride back to your hotel around noon, leaving you refreshed and enriched by your rural adventure.

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our provides hotel pickup and return within Hoi An city and beach area, making it convenient for travelers staying locally.
How long does the tour last?
It is approximately 5 hours, allowing enough time to enjoy each activity without feeling rushed.
What activities are involved?
You’ll bike to the village, learn to navigate a basket boat, fish with traditional methods, ride a water buffalo, and cook a local meal.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Yes, it’s family-friendly, though children should be comfortable with outdoor activities and small group settings.
What should I wear?
Comfortable, weather-appropriate clothing is recommended, especially for biking and outdoor activities. Don’t forget a hat and sunscreen.
Is food included?
Yes, a home-cooked lunch (or dinner if you choose the afternoon tour) is included, prepared at a local family’s home.
Are drinks provided?
Purified water and wet tissues are supplied, but additional beverages are your responsibility.
What if the weather is bad?
The tour requires good weather; if canceled due to po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
How many people can join?
The tour runs for a minimum of 2 people and is private or small-group, ensuring personalized attention.
Can I participate if I don’t speak English?
The guide is English-speaking, making communication straightforward for most travelers.
